Undertaking difficult cases to help define the standard of practice under the law: When a healthcare provider fails to meet the governing standard of medical practice, the negligent act can result in serious injury or even death. Both doctors and hospitals are required to provide care that meets minimum standards. When they fail patients and families are harmed. Types of Medical Malpractices Include:

  • Surgical Errors
  • Birth Injuries
  • Misdiagnosis/Failure to Diagnose
  • Anesthetic errors
  • Prescription and medication errors
